employees, families and friends participate in Duluth’s dragon boat race each summer
people filter
back to company directory

Christian Kroll

Mechanical Designer

Profile Picture

Christian Kroll provides mechanical design services for projects related to process piping and pumping systems, industrial ventilation, industrial machinery and equipment, and conveyor systems as well as building systems for industrial processing facilities, refineries, power plants, and other heavy industrial facilities. His work primarily involves developing equipment layout, conducting mechanical design using AutoCAD and three-dimensional modeling software, and completing construction plans and specifications. Christian has also assisted with routing of cable and grounding inside pipeline substations and terminals as well as with modeling and elevation detailing for slab, pier, and structure steel designs.


(218) 529-7103


Barr Engineering Co.
325 South Lake Avenue
Duluth, MN 55802

Phone: 218-529-8200
Fax: 218-529-8202
Toll free: 800-786-5830